What a Weapon or Cannon Means in a Dream
Seeing a weapon or cannon in a dream is a sign of powerful inner energy seeking an outlet. It is a symbol of strength, conflict, and change, and what a weapon signifies in a dream often points to mounting tension in your life. Such a dream can be both a warning of upcoming trials and a call to take control of the situation.
What a Weapon Means in a Dream
A weapon in a dream is, above all, a symbol of aggression, defense, or decisive action. It may reflect your desire to "fire" — that is, to voice pent-up emotions, assert your boundaries, or radically change a situation. A dream about a weapon is often linked to feelings of vulnerability and a simultaneous urge to shield yourself from the outside world.
The details of the dream play a key role. Hearing the sound of cannon fire may signify alarming news or a premonition of conflict. If you are firing a cannon — you are trying to actively influence those around you, but perhaps you are doing so too bluntly. Seeing a weapon aimed at you is a sign that you feel pressure or a threat from someone. Conversely, a dormant, old weapon may symbolize past conflicts and accumulated but unused strength.
A Psychological Perspective
From the standpoint of modern psychology, a weapon in a dream is a metaphor for your psychic energy. Emotions you suppress while awake take on the form of a powerful, explosive instrument in dreams. The dream may suggest that you are in a state of internal conflict, where one part of you wants to act decisively while another avoids confrontation. It is important to analyze the emotion you felt: fear, anger, or confidence.
In the Jungian tradition, a weapon is an archetype of the Shadow — that part of the psyche we do not accept in ourselves. A cannon or weapon may embody repressed aggression, a desire for power, or destruction. The dream urges you not to ignore this "shadow" side but to acknowledge it and channel its force into a constructive direction. It is also a symbol of transformation: the destruction of the old (like a shot) may be necessary to build something new. Folk Dream Book
According to folk beliefs and Miller's dream book, a weapon and a cannon are symbols of misfortune and calamity. It was believed that hearing the sound of a weapon in a dream portends job loss or major errors in affairs requiring leadership. If you dream that you are shooting someone, folk wisdom promises disgrace and condemnation. Being shot in a dream is a warning against the machinations of ill-wishers and possible illness. For a woman, hearing gunfire points to scandalous incidents that could tarnish her reputation, and for a married lady, such a dream portends troubles caused by other women. However, these interpretations are merely echoes of ancient beliefs, and they should not be taken as a verdict.
